University of Arkansas listed among top party schools

Screengrab: Unigo.com

Earlier today, the Razorback football team was ranked in the Top 10 of the Associated Press poll for the 13th consecutive time.

Shortly after that, we found out the University of Arkansas recently made it into an entirely different Top 10 list.

Arkansas was ranked No. 4 on the “Fifty Shades of Cray,” a list of the top party schools as complied by college ranking website Unigo.com and The Huffington Post.

According to the site, over 30,000 students voted in the 2013 rankings in a variety of categories, including happiest sudents, hipster colleges, unique traditions, and others.

Fellow SEC schools Ole Miss and Georgia also made the list, and the University of South Florida landed at No. 1.
